This simulator uses compound interest to project future wealth. Note that high returns in Pakistan (15%+) are often accompanied by equally high inflation. Your 'real' return is the difference between your investment return and inflation.

How to Build a Retirement Corpus in Pakistan?
Building a retirement corpus requires consistent monthly savings and investing in assets that compound over time, such as Mutual Funds, Stocks (PSX), or National Savings Schemes.
The Power of Compounding
Compound interest means earning interest on your interest. Over 10 to 20 years, the wealth gained from compounding usually far exceeds your actual principal investments.
F.I.R.E Movement
Financial Independence, Retire Early (FIRE) is a movement where individuals aggressively save (up to 50% of their income) to retire in their 40s instead of the traditional age of 60.
